All-in-One Dashboard for Streamlined HR Functions
The perfect HRMS platform provides a comprehensive dashboard that brings together all essential HR functions—like recruitment, payroll, onboarding, and employee records—into one easy-to-use interface. This centralized access allows HR teams to make quicker decisions and gain a complete view of organizational metrics.

Effortless Onboarding for New Employees
A smooth onboarding experience is crucial for keeping employees engaged and happy. Modern HR software automates document collection, assigns training, and sets up role-specific workflows, making sure new hires hit the ground running from day one. The HRMS should also allow for personalized onboarding experiences that reflect the company’s culture.

Systematic Attendance and Leave Management
Keeping accurate tabs on employee time, attendance, and leave balances is key to effective human resource management. With automated leave policies, multi-tier approvals, and biometric integration, HR software helps eliminate errors while ensuring transparency.

Sophisticated Payroll Integration and Compliance
Payroll is the heartbeat of HR operations. A top-notch HR management system seamlessly connects payroll with attendance, benefits, and tax data. It guarantees timely payments, precise calculations, and strict compliance with regulations across different regions.

Talent Management and Skill Mapping with PMS Tools
To attract and keep the best talent, it’s essential to have a clear understanding of what your workforce can do. With talent management tools and AI-powered skill mapping, HR software can pinpoint skill gaps, create development paths, and ensure that employee skills align with the company’s strategic goals.

Learning and Development Module Through LMS
A solid HRMS platform equipped with comprehensive training modules fosters a culture of continuous learning. Features such as course scheduling, e-learning portals, training feedback, and skill assessments help keep employee development in sync with the organization’s growth objectives.

Employee Self-Service Portals
Today’s employees value the ability to manage their own personal information. Self-service portals in HR management systems give staff the power to update their records, request time off, download payslips, and monitor performance reviews—reducing reliance on HR teams and boosting overall satisfaction.

HR Reporting and Real-Time Analytics
Having access to real-time HR analytics is crucial in 2025. The HRMS platform should provide smart dashboards and customizable report generation features to track employee performance, attrition trends, and engagement metrics—enabling HR leaders to make informed, data-driven decisions.

HR Data Security and Compliance Controls
As HR data becomes more digital, the demand for robust data security grows. A trustworthy HR management system must include multi-factor authentication, encrypted storage, role-based access, and automated compliance alerts to protect sensitive employee information and provide HR data security.

Integration with External Applications and APIs
To maintain a smooth workflow, HR software needs to integrate seamlessly with third-party applications like ERP systems, accounting software, and job portals. API connectivity and easy plug-and-play integrations ensure that data exchange is efficient and error-free.

Mobile Accessibility for On-the-Go HR Management
In today’s hybrid work environment, being mobile is a must. A mobile-friendly HRMS platform allows HR teams and employees to access essential HR functions from anywhere, enhancing responsiveness and boosting efficiency.

Customization Capabilities for Diverse Business Needs
Every business has its own identity, and so do its HR challenges. A flexible and customizable HR software enables organizations to adjust modules, workflows, and interfaces to meet specific industry requirements, compliance standards, and workforce dynamics.

HR Process Automation for Operational Efficiency
Automating HR processes lightens the administrative load, cuts out unnecessary steps, and speeds up task completion. From automated reminders and approvals to AI-driven resume screening, automation brings agility to human resource management.

Performance Management with Real-Time Feedback
Gone are the days when annual reviews sufficed. Real-time feedback systems, goal tracking, and comprehensive performance reviews within the HRMS platform promote ongoing development and ensure clarity in employee evaluations.

Scalable Architecture for Future-Ready HR Teams
As companies expand, their HR systems need to keep pace. A scalable HR management system accommodates multi-location operations, growing employee numbers, and new module integrations without sacrificing performance or data security.
